Workshop on Women Protection Laws and Gender Issues

The Women Development Centre, University of Sargodha, organized a Workshop on Women Protection Laws and Gender Issues at the Research Arena on March 5, 2024, in collaboration with the Institute for Sustainable Development Foundation (IFSD). The workshop was facilitated by Gul Hassan Abbas, Executive Director IFSD, and attended by 34 students and faculty members.

The event aimed to enhance awareness and understanding of women’s rights, legal protection mechanisms, and gender-related challenges. Participants were introduced to key women protection laws in Pakistan and engaged in discussions on gender equality, social inclusion, and the importance of creating safe and supportive environments for women.

During the session, Gul Hassan Abbas highlighted the role of legal frameworks, educational institutions, and community engagement in promoting gender justice and protecting women’s rights. The workshop encouraged participants to critically reflect on gender issues and explore practical approaches to fostering equality and respect within their communities.

The interactive session provided a platform for dialogue and knowledge sharing, enabling participants to gain a deeper understanding of contemporary gender-related challenges and the collective responsibility to address them. The workshop concluded with a question-and-answer session, allowing participants to exchange ideas and discuss strategies for advancing gender equality.

The event reflects the University of Sargodha’s continued commitment to promoting awareness, inclusivity, and social responsibility through educational and capacity-building initiatives.
